Parenting with
Nonviolence
A series of classes designed to support parents and whaanau of children of all ages. Parenting with nonviolence is a philosophy and practice that fosters healthy connected relationships with each other.
We will learn about:
-
Empathy
-
Regulation tools
-
Anger - yours and your child's
-
What nonviolence means
-
Supportive guidance
Created by Ruth Beaglehole and supported by Te Mauri Tau, we continue this ongoing journey of parenting and support each other to learn skills that will bring deeper connection with our children. This course, delivered in English, is for anyone interested in learning about parenting with aroha and nonviolence.
